The play-offs for the Saudi Roshn Professional League (SPL) kick off on Friday, with four clubs competing for the third promotion spot from the Yelo of First Division League (FDL) of Professional Clubs.
Al-Hazem, Al-Adalah, Al-Bukayriyah and Al-Tai clubs have booked the play-off spots. Al-Hazem, Al-Adalah and Al-Bukayriyah clubs qualified by securing third, fifth and sixth places respectively, while Al-Tai (the seventh-placed team) qualified for the play-offs instead of Al-Jabalain (the fourth-placed team) for not meeting the Roshn Professional League club license criteria.
According to the playoff system, Al-Hazem will meet Al-Tai, while Al-Adalah will meet Al-Bukayriyah in the playoff semi-finals at the stadiums of the two clubs mentioned first, on Friday evening. The final will be played at the stadium of the team with the best ranking between the two finalists.

Al-Adalah will host Al-Bukayriyah in the first semi-final on Friday evening at Prince Abdullah bin Jalawi Sports City Stadium in Al-Ahsa.
The two teams finished their Yelo League campaign in fifth and sixth place, with the same number of points (58 points) each. However, Al-Adalah’s superiority in head-to-head matches gave it the advantage in the standings, allowing it to host the play-off semi-final match at its home stadium.
Al-Adalah defeated Al-Bukayriyah in the first round of the Yelo League, with two clean goals, the same result that decided the return match at Al-Bukayriyah Stadium for the 18th round.

Al-Hazem will host Al-Ta’ee at their home stadium in Al-Rass on Friday evening in the second playoff semi-final match. Al-Hazem has a chance to advance to the Premier League, especially since if they win, they will play the playoff final at their home stadium as the best-ranked club in the playoffs.
Al-Hazem won the first round of the Yelo League against Al-Tai, winning 2-1 away, before they tied in the second round at Al-Hazem Stadium, 1-1.
It is noteworthy that both teams are seeking a quick return to the Roshn Saudi League, having previously been among its clubs during the 2023-2024 season before finishing in the bottom two places.
